
Do You Want to Read the Bible, But Don’t Know How to Begin?
You’re in luck! The Arvada 24-week Great Adventure Bible Timeline (GABT) study will start again this September and continue through next March! The Great Adventure Bible Timeline makes reading the Bible not only easy, but exciting! In this study, you will learn the major people, places, events and themes of the Bible— you will get the “big picture” of our own salvation history. Through The Great Adventure Bible Timeline you may understand, for the first time in your life, how the Bible stories fit together. This learning can make your Bible reading, and even the Sunday Mass readings come alive like never before.

For those who have already taken the GABT last year, a 24-week study of the book of Matthew will also begin this September. Building directly on the foundation laid in The Great Adventure Bible Timeline, Step Two in The Great Adventure Bible Study Program, Matthew, shows how Jesus builds on the foundation laid in the Old Testament to inaugurate the Kingdom of Heaven on earth. For this reason, it is an ideal follow-up study to the basic narrative of Scripture taught in The Bible Timeline course.

In the future, The Great Adventure Bible studies are planned to be offered each Fall in Arvada parishes. It is suggested that a participant begin with the Bible Timeline study, and then if interested, move on to take Matthew and then Acts, in that order. The Bible Timeline study is the foundational course for all other Great Adventure Bible studies, and is the one to take before taking any other of the 24-week studies.
